Frequently Asked Questions

Who pays Machinists more: Spain or Japan?โ–พ

Japan pays Machinists an estimated $26,424 USD per year, which is 2% more than Spain's estimated $25,870 USD.

What is the PPP-adjusted salary for a Machinist in Spain vs Japan?โ–พ

The PPP-adjusted salary is $62,351 USD in Spain and $59,409 USD in Japan. PPP adjustment accounts for cost of living differences between the two countries.

How does the purchasing power compare for Machinists?โ–พ

Using the Big Mac Index, a Machinist in Spain can buy about 4,712 Big Macs per year, while in Japan it's about 8,750 Big Macs.
